Book NowAbout The Henry Blue Mountains
Perched right on the Great Western Highway in Lawson, this heritage stop pairs classic pub comfort with all-day kitchen hours. Travellers coming off Blue Mountains bushwalks duck in for a schooner of Mountain Culture craft beer beneath stained-glass windows and historic timber arches. The kitchen skips the typical mid-afternoon split shift, turning out charred beef burgers, thick cuts of Sunday roast pork, and chicken parmigianas through 3pm and straight into dinner. Tuesday nights fill fast for the steak special, served alongside crispy halloumi chips.
- All-Day Kitchen Hours: Full lunch and dinner menus run continuously through the mid-afternoon without a split-service closure.
- Classic Mountain Feeds: Pours regional craft beers like Mountain Culture alongside a hearty roster of ribeye steaks, parmis, and roasts.
- Heritage Transit Stop: Restored timber interiors and boutique rooms sit directly opposite Lawson Train Station.

Before you head over
Practical guidance on timing, reservations, and arrival for your visit
Drop In for Mid-Afternoon Dining
The kitchen operates continuously throughout the day without standard afternoon pauses, making it an ideal stop for a 3pm meal when returning from the mountains.
Book Ahead on Specials Nights
Special promotional dining occasions like steak nights get quite busy, so reserving your table ahead of time is recommended to ensure seating.
Use Rear Parking or Rail Access
Dedicated off-street parking is available behind the pub, and Lawson Train Station sits directly opposite across the highway for simple rail transit.
